The bunker under Stockholm

The most famous example sits about thirty metres beneath a park in Stockholm. Pionen, run by the Swedish provider Bahnhof, was built inside a former civil-defence nuclear shelter blasted out of solid granite. When it was redesigned in the late 2000s, the architects leaned all the way into the science-fiction feel: glass-walled meeting rooms suspended over the server floor, simulated daylight, greenhouses, indoor waterfalls, and backup generators salvaged from submarines. It became briefly notorious as a host for WikiLeaks, and it remains the picture people reach for when they imagine a Bond-villain server room, because it genuinely looks like one.

Servers down a missile silo

Pionen is not alone. Around the world, decommissioned Cold War missile silos and military bunkers have been reborn as data centres, their metres-thick concrete and remote locations turning out to be ideal for people who want their servers physically unreachable. The same instinct that once protected warheads now protects dedicated servers. Old limestone mines and deep caverns do similar duty, offering natural cooling, total physical security and protection from almost anything happening on the surface.

Microsoft sank a data centre in the sea

The strangest experiment of all went the other way, down rather than in. In 2018 Microsoft, as part of a project called Natick, sealed a cylinder full of servers and sank it onto the seabed off the coast of Orkney in Scotland, powered by renewable energy. When the capsule was hauled back up two years later, the result was surprising: the underwater servers had failed far less often than identical machines on land, roughly a fraction of the rate. The cool, stable water and the sealed, oxygen-free atmosphere inside the capsule had simply been kinder to the hardware than a normal room full of air and people.

Why go to such lengths

Strip away the drama and the motives are sober. Underground sites are easy to keep cool and almost impossible to break into. Bunkers shrug off fire, flood, storms and intruders. Remote locations near cold water or cheap renewable power cut the single largest running cost, which is keeping thousands of machines from overheating. The aesthetics are a bonus; the engineering is the point.
